Veyo, Utah - Rena Gubler Leavitt passed away early Monday morning, April 23, 2012 from causes incident to old age. She was born in Santa Clara, Utah on October 28, 1923 to Esther Stucki and Casper Ensign Gubler. She spent her growing up years in Santa Clara, and enjoyed a happy childhood even though economic times were tough for her family. She attended grades one through six at the old rock school house in Santa Clara and graduated from Dixie High School in St. George.

Rena married Edward Leo Leavitt on January 5, 1946 in Las Vegas, Nevada just ten days after Leo returned from WWII. Their marriage was sealed for time and eternity in the St. George LDS Temple on January 11, 1947. She lived most of her marriage life in Veyo, Utah.

Rena is the mother of five surviving children: one son, Steven Leo (Rae) Leavitt of Veyo; four daughters: Doris (Mike) Johnson and Sandra (Larry) Staheli both of Veyo, LaRene (Dean) Cox of St. George and Vicky Sue (Stuart) Morris also of Veyo. Her posterity includes twenty grandchildren and thirty great-gr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her loving husband, E. Leo Leavitt; her parents; a brother, Norman Ensign Gubler; and sisters: Marvel Joy Gubler, Veda Blossom Lyle, Florence Mary Hunter, Mae Whitehead, Nina Atkin and Doreen Gubler.
